Everything You Need to Understand About Roofing Providers: Professional Installment, Quality Repair Works, and Preventive Maintenance Roof covering services play an essential duty in maintaining the stability of any kind of home. From professional setup to quality repair services and preventative upkeep, these elements are essential for protecting homes. Homeowners https://archervxqpk.blogocial.com/instant-solutions-for-emergency-roof-repair-riverside-when-damage-strike-74110320